Job Description

The Medical Science Liaison (MSL) is designed to promote scientific activity and standards of care for patients, providers and healthcare payers, and to ensure that they have access to all the practical and clinically relevant information and options they need to use AbbVie products effectively and safely. 

  1. Coordinate scientific and technical work to strengthen professional and credible relationships with opinion leaders and external experts of strategic importance to AbbVie.
  2. Ensure AbbVie's strong scientific and medical representation in key academic centers by facilitating research and educational initiatives, while responding to requests for medical and scientific information about products or areas of therapeutic interest for AbbVie.
  3. It helps internal teams, such as the sales and marketing team and members of the brand promotion team, to develop their scientific and technical expertise by presenting the latest news in the field.  It maintains a transdisciplinary collaboration with other members in the territory, while maintaining its operational independence.
  4. Participates in the initiation, supervision and follow-up phases of clinical trials and medical projects initiated within the therapeutic area for which MSL is responsible (e.g. post-market clinical activities such as register/database-based projects, epidemiological studies, post-authorization (phase IV) safety studies).  All these activities must be conducted in accordance with applicable laws, guidelines, codes of best practice, local Standard Operating Procedures (POS) and AbbVie Research and Development POS.
  5. Interact with opinion leaders to promote the ideas and proposals of Investigator Initiated Studies (IIS) to gain the support of global and local medical teams, as appropriate.
  6. Represents the contact person within the medical marketing team that external opinion leaders and experts from a specific geographic area can reach to meet their scientific information needs in a specific therapeutic area and, upon request, provides information on relevant AbbVie medicines to promote their safe, effective and appropriate use.
  7. Delivers documented presentations on scientific topics for physicians, individually or in groups (at meetings, medical sessions, etc.), when requested, but specifically targeting opinion leaders at levels 1 and 2.
  8. Participates in the selection process to identify appropriately qualified opinion leaders that the Company would like to co-opt as collaborators — such as potential collaborators in the field of research, or for advisory and educational positions (Advisory Councils, congresses, symposia, etc.); at the same time must maintain a high level of scientific integrity or educational during these cooperative endeavors.
  9. Facilitate the exchange of information in the medical and scientific fields — for example, competitive analysis and medical strategies, educational activities — and facilitate communication, where appropriate, within the Company.
  10. Participation in relevant scientific meetings and conferences. Collaborate with internally interested agencies to develop summaries of key data and other relevant scientific information and to publicize Abbvie's strategic priorities and initiatives.
  11. At their request, assist physicians who request AbbVie medicines for a specific patient indicated or as compassionate use, in compliance with all applicable legal and regulatory requirements.
  12. Provide relevant opinion leaders/external experts and internal clinical and medical teams with technical and scientific assistance for publications of medical or scientific interest.
  13. It is responsible for ensuring that all activities and interactions are conducted in compliance with all applicable national, global and local laws, regulations, guidelines, codes of conduct, Company policies and accepted standards of best practice in the field.

 


Qualifications

  • A high academic training (e.g. Doctor of Pharmacy, Doctor of Medicine, Doctor of Science) in a relevant scientific field is preferable, but candidates licensed in a relevant discipline with demonstrated experience are also considered.
  • Experience in developing and maintaining a high level of expertise in the assigned therapeutic field as well as medical research in general.
  • Solid knowledge of the pharmaceutical environment and the role of the medical marketing department in achieving the medical and scientific objectives of a pharmaceutical company.
  • Demonstrated expertise in the field of scientific methodology applied to clinical research and current legislative/regulatory control activities applicable to this research.
  • Ability to assimilate complex knowledge about new areas and environments.
  • Excellent verbal and written presentation and communication skills and demonstrated ability to develop and maintain close collaborative relationships with opinion leaders, physicians and other healthcare decision-makers.
  • Preferably a good grasp of English, written and oral level.
  • Strong customer-oriented approach.
  • Explicit commitment to respect relevant rules and procedures and to uphold scientific integrity and quality
